基本的なMVVMとデータバインディングのサンプルはこちら 概要 XamarinのページのPart 5. From Data Bindings to MVVMのInteractive MVVMの章のRGB版です。 前の章に関しては一番上のリンクからどうぞ R,G,Bのスライダーを操作するとLabelの色が変わるサンプルを作ります。 インタラクティブ(相互作用)というタイトルの通り、バインドの方向を双方向にします。 ViewModel Viewモデルには、ラベルの色Colorインスタンスのプロパティと、double型のRed,Green,Blueプロパティを持つことにします。 プロパティの変更をViewに伝えるためにINotifyPropertyChangedインターフェイスを実装します。 namespace XamarinSample2 { class RGBViewModel : INot
